Description

This rapid presents a technical descent with multiple mid-stream boulder obstacles that require precise boat positioning and strategic maneuvering. Paddlers should be prepared to navigate a series of offset rocks near the center and right side of the channel, with potential for pin hazards during low to moderate water levels. Recommended line runs close to the left bank before cutting right to avoid the most significant obstructions.
